Celanese Corporation VECTRA E130i 699

Description
When using short metering strokes an accumulator is recommended to get short injection times. VECTRA should in principle be predried. Because of the necessary low maximum residual moisture content the use of dry air dryers is recommended. The dew point should be =< - 40° C. The time between drying and processing should be as short as possible.
